    I was craving nachos and wanted to try something new. So I asked ChatGPT what was the best nachos in the city. They pointed me to El Vez. I ordered it for pickup using DoorDash and it was ready in about 15 minutes. [[HIGHLIGHT]]El Vez is located all the way downtown near Battery Park. Looks like they took over the old Blue Smoke space (RIP), so the restaurant is pretty large.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] I was surprised when I went to pick it up and they handed me a square pizza box. This is actually something unique that makes it good. The biggest issue with nachos is that only the top chips have toppings and the bottom ones are naked. Not these nachos, they're laid it flat so every chip is covered. I ordered the Macho Nacho Chorizo and I would get it again. Is it the best I've ever had? Maybe not. But it's pretty good.

    [[HIGHLIGHT]]This is a nice restaurant nestled close to the world trade center memorial site.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] [[HIGHLIGHT]]Its very spacious and has some cool decorations on the wall.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] They have large plate kids meals. We got the cheese quesidillas and the kids nachos. They devoured it. The side of rice and beans were not too spicy for the kids. And they loved the fruit as well. I got the adult nachos. They are served on a plate with ample toppings. We also got the chicken enchiladas. Those were bathed in a mole type of sauce. It definitely needed hot sauce. It took a while to get a server to come back with the hot sauce but it was worth it. They had an orange one that was milder and a red one that was much more spicy. It was filling and good. Prices were fair for NYC.
